<div><h3>Overview</h3><p>As an Engineer - Rides&Attractions Electrical at Six Flags Qiddiya City and Aquarabia, you will play a vital role in ensuring the reliable and safe operation of electrical systems for rides and attractions. Your expertise will contribute to creating a thrilling and enjoyable environment for our guests while maintaining the highest standards of safety and efficiency.</p><h3>Responsibilities</h3><ul><li>Design and Development: Collaborate with the engineering team in the design, development, and implementation of electrical systems for new rides and attractions, ensuring compliance with safety standards.</li><li>Electrical Maintenance: Conduct regular maintenance, troubleshooting, and repairs on electrical systems, control panels, and related equipment for rides and attractions.</li><li>Safety Compliance: Ensure all electrical installations and modifications meet established safety codes and regulations, conducting risk assessments and safety audits as needed.</li><li>Technical Support: Provide technical support and expertise to maintenance teams during routine inspections, repairs, and emergency situations related to electrical systems.</li><li>Documentation: Maintain accurate records of electrical maintenance activities, inspections, and repairs, along with detailed documentation of electrical schematics and design changes.</li><li>Collaboration: Work closely with the operations and safety teams to ensure that all electrical systems function effectively and can be safely operated by ride attendants.</li><li>Continuous Improvement: Stay updated on emerging technologies and industry trends related to electrical engineering and amusement ride systems, recommending innovative solutions to improve operational reliability.</li><li>Training: Assist in training maintenance staff on the proper operation, troubleshooting, and maintenance of electrical systems to enhance their effectiveness.</li></ul><h3>Qualifications</h3><ul><li>Education: Bachelor\'s Deg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field.</li><li>Experience: 2-5 years of experience in electrical engineering, specifically within the amusement park or entertainment industry is preferred.</li><li>Skills: Strong knowledge of electrical systems, controls, and safety protocols specific to rides and attractions.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ics and technical documentation. Experience with PLC programming, VFDs, and automation systems.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to troubleshoot complex electrical issues. Effective communication and collaboration skills with the ability to work within a team environment. Familiarity with ASME and NEC standards related to amusement rides.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int. Knowledge of comput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S) is a plus.</li></ul></div>#J-18808-Ljbffr
